3大显示技术挑战:ColorControl如何实现专业级色彩管理与设备控制
3大显示技术挑战ColorControl如何实现专业级色彩管理与设备控制【免费下载链接】ColorControlEasily change NVIDIA display settings and/or control LG TVs项目地址: https://gitcode.com/gh_mirrors/co/ColorControl在数字内容创作和多媒体消费日益普及的今天专业用户面临着三大核心显示技术挑战HDR/SDR模式切换导致的亮度不一致、多设备色彩管理的复杂性、以及高级显示参数调节的技术门槛。ColorControl作为一个开源显示控制工具为NVIDIA/AMD显卡用户和LG/Samsung电视用户提供了系统级的解决方案。HDR/SDR动态切换的技术实现HDR模式切换的延迟优化Windows系统在HDR与SDR内容切换时存在亮度适配问题ColorControl通过精细化的延迟参数配置解决了这一痛点。在Options.png界面中可以看到HDR部分专门设置了Delay opening display settings (ms)参数默认值为700ms。这个延迟时间确保了HDR模式切换的稳定性避免了因切换过快导致的显示闪烁或黑屏问题。对于LG电视用户ColorControl还提供了Delay before powering on after resume (ms)设置默认值为5000ms。这个较长的延迟确保了电视从待机状态恢复时网络连接稳定避免因网络未就绪导致的控制失败。亮度平衡算法ColorControl通过NVIDIA驱动接口直接控制SDR内容在HDR模式下的亮度级别避免了Windows系统自动调节带来的亮度失衡。关键配置参数包括SDR内容亮度系数可调节范围0-100%默认值为50%HDR峰值亮度映射支持PQ曲线和HLG两种HDR标准色彩空间自动转换在HDR/sRGB/BT.2020之间智能切换NVIDIA/AMD显卡高级色彩管理色彩参数的多维度控制在NvPresets.png界面中ColorControl展示了其强大的NVIDIA控制器功能。用户可以为不同应用场景创建多个显示模式预设每个预设包含以下关键参数色深设置Bit Depth支持6-16位色深调节BPC88位/通道适合日常办公和网页浏览BPC1010位/通道提供更高动态范围适用于影视后期和HDR游戏BPC1212位/通道专业级色彩精度需求颜色格式Color FormatRGB原生RGB格式适合设计工作和色彩敏感应用YCbCr444无损色彩压缩适合视频播放YCbCr422带宽优化格式适合高刷新率游戏动态范围Dynamic RangeVESA全范围RGB0-255PC标准CEA有限范围RGB16-235电视标准色彩空间Color SpacesRGB标准网页和办公色彩空间Adobe RGB专业摄影和印刷色彩空间BT.2020超高清视频标准色彩空间DCI-P3数字影院标准色彩空间预设管理的最佳实践ColorControl的预设系统支持复杂的多条件触发机制// 预设配置示例 { name: 专业设计模式, bitDepth: 10, colorFormat: RGB, dynamicRange: VESA, colorSpace: AdobeRGB, refreshRate: 60, dithering: { mode: Temporal, bitDepth: 8 }, hdr: { enabled: false, sdrBrightness: 50 }, shortcut: WinShiftD }色域映射与色彩精度对于专业色彩工作ColorControl通过NVIDIA驱动API实现了精确的色域映射3D LUT支持可加载自定义3D查找表进行色彩校正伽马曲线调节支持sRGB、2.2、2.4等多种伽马曲线白点校准可调整色温从2500K到10000K色彩饱和度控制独立调节红、绿、蓝三原色的饱和度LG/Samsung智能电视的自动化控制设备发现与连接管理ColorControl采用UPnP通用即插即用协议自动发现局域网内的LG WebOS和Samsung Tizen电视。在LgController.png界面中可以看到设备信息显示区域包括设备型号如OLED55C9PLA、IP地址和友好名称。连接建立过程自动发现启动时扫描局域网内的电视设备授权请求首次连接时显示授权弹窗会话保持维护持久化连接避免重复授权状态监控实时监测电视电源状态和输入源自动化电源管理ColorControl提供了完整的电视电源自动化方案自动化场景触发条件执行动作延迟设置开机同步PC启动完成电视自动开机5000ms等待网络就绪待机恢复PC从睡眠唤醒电视自动开机3000ms关机同步PC关机电视自动关机立即执行屏保联动PC进入屏保电视自动关机可配置延迟屏保结束PC退出屏保电视自动开机可配置延迟遥控命令的脚本化执行ColorControl的预设系统支持复杂的遥控命令序列执行如截图中的oledDown (10)预设// LG电视遥控命令序列示例 { name: 游戏模式切换, app: com.webos.app.home, steps: [ HOME:500, // 按主页键等待500ms RIGHT:300, // 向右导航 DOWN:300, // 向下导航 ENTER:1000, // 进入设置等待1秒 DOWN:200, // 向下导航到图像设置 DOWN:200, // 继续向下 ENTER:500, // 进入图像模式 DOWN:200, // 选择游戏模式 ENTER:1000 // 确认选择 ], shortcut: CtrlAltG }多设备色彩一致性管理ICC配置文件管理ColorControl集成了ICC色彩配置文件管理系统配置文件加载支持加载显示器校准生成的ICC文件配置文件切换根据应用场景自动切换色彩配置文件配置文件验证验证ICC文件的完整性和兼容性系统集成将配置文件正确注册到Windows色彩管理系统跨设备色彩同步对于多显示器工作环境ColorControl提供了色彩同步功能主从显示器配置指定一个显示器作为色彩参考标准色彩参数复制将主显示器的色彩设置复制到从显示器亮度平衡调节根据显示器特性自动平衡多显示器亮度色温匹配确保所有显示器显示一致的白色专业色彩工作流针对专业用户ColorControl支持完整的色彩工作流管理设计模式切换到Adobe RGB色彩空间启用10位色深视频编辑模式切换到Rec.709或BT.2020色彩空间打印预览模式加载打印机ICC配置文件进行软打样演示模式切换到sRGB色彩空间确保色彩一致性性能优化与故障排除响应时间优化ColorControl通过以下技术优化响应时间并行处理多个显示设置变更并行执行增量更新只修改发生变化的参数缓存机制缓存常用配置减少API调用异步操作非阻塞式UI操作保持界面响应常见问题解决方案问题现象可能原因解决方案HDR切换黑屏显示器EDID信息不完整手动配置显示器参数色彩空间切换失败显卡驱动版本过旧更新到最新NVIDIA/AMD驱动LG电视连接失败防火墙阻止UPnP配置防火墙允许UPnP通信预设执行缓慢网络延迟或电视响应慢增加步骤间的延迟时间色彩配置文件失效Windows色彩服务未运行重启Windows色彩服务调试与日志系统ColorControl内置了详细的日志系统记录所有操作和错误信息!-- 日志配置示例 -- logging level valueDEBUG / appender typeFile file valueColorControl.log / layout typePatternLayout pattern value%d{yyyy-MM-dd HH:mm:ss} [%thread] %-5level %logger - %msg%n / /layout /appender /logging高级配置与脚本集成命令行接口ColorControl提供了完整的命令行接口支持自动化脚本集成# 执行NVIDIA预设 ColorControl.exe --nvpreset 设计模式 # 执行LG电视预设 ColorControl.exe --lgpreset 影院模式 --device 客厅电视 # 切换HDR模式 ColorControl.exe --hdr on # 批量执行多个预设 ColorControl.exe --batch presets.json触发器系统ColorControl的触发器系统支持基于进程的自动配置切换{ trigger: { processName: Photoshop.exe, action: applyPreset, presetName: AdobeRGB模式, condition: { windowTitle: *Photoshop*, priority: high } } }远程控制API对于高级用户ColorControl提供了REST API接口# Python控制示例 import requests # 切换显示模式 response requests.post( http://localhost:8080/api/preset/apply, json{preset: 游戏模式, device: 主显示器} ) # 获取当前状态 status requests.get(http://localhost:8080/api/status)技术架构与扩展性模块化设计ColorControl采用模块化架构每个设备类型都有独立的服务模块NVIDIA服务模块处理NVIDIA显卡相关操作AMD服务模块处理AMD显卡相关操作LG服务模块处理LG电视控制Samsung服务模块处理Samsung电视控制色彩配置文件服务管理ICC配置文件游戏启动器模块游戏相关的显示优化插件系统ColorControl支持第三方插件扩展开发者可以添加新设备支持实现新的设备控制接口扩展功能模块添加新的显示调节功能集成外部工具与校色仪、色彩分析仪等工具集成自定义UI组件创建专用的控制界面跨平台兼容性虽然ColorControl主要面向Windows平台但其架构设计考虑了跨平台兼容性.NET Core基础使用跨平台的.NET Core框架平台抽象层设备控制接口的平台抽象配置文件兼容跨平台的配置文件格式依赖管理自动处理平台特定的依赖项最佳实践指南专业色彩工作流配置显示器校准使用校色仪生成ICC配置文件预设创建为不同工作场景创建专用预设设计工作Adobe RGB色彩空间10位色深视频编辑Rec.709色彩空间HDR模式游戏娱乐sRGB色彩空间高刷新率自动化切换配置进程触发器自动切换预设定期验证每月使用测试图案验证色彩准确性多显示器环境管理主显示器指定选择色彩最准确的显示器作为参考色彩匹配使用ColorControl的色彩同步功能亮度平衡根据环境光调整各显示器亮度输入源管理为每个显示器分配专用输入源电视作为显示器的优化输入延迟优化启用游戏模式降低输入延迟色彩模式选择根据内容类型选择色彩模式自动电源管理配置与PC的电源联动遥控器模拟创建常用操作的快捷键通过ColorControl的系统级显示控制能力专业用户和爱好者可以充分发挥显示设备的潜力实现精确的色彩管理和高效的设备控制提升工作流程的效率和视觉体验的质量。【免费下载链接】ColorControlEasily change NVIDIA display settings and/or control LG TVs项目地址: https://gitcode.com/gh_mirrors/co/ColorControl创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2640298.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!